The Importance Of Reel Templates In Video Production

In the world of video production, having a well-organized and visually appealing reel is essential for showcasing your work and attracting potential clients. This is where reel templates come into play. A reel template is a pre-designed layout that allows you to easily create a professional and engaging reel that highlights your best work. In this article, we will explore the importance of reel templates in video production and how they can help elevate your portfolio.

First and foremost, reel templates offer a streamlined approach to creating a video reel. Instead of starting from scratch every time you need to update your reel, you can simply plug in your footage and customize the template to fit your style and brand. This not only saves you time and effort but also ensures consistency across all of your reels. By using a template, you can easily swap out clips, add text and graphics, and make other edits without having to reformat the entire layout.

Additionally, reel templates can help you stand out from the competition. With so many video producers vying for clients’ attention, having a well-designed reel that catches the eye is crucial. A template provides you with a polished and professional layout that showcases your work in the best light possible. Whether you are looking to land a new client or showcase your talent to potential employers, a well-crafted reel can make all the difference.

Furthermore, reel templates can help you tell a cohesive story with your work. A good reel should flow smoothly from one clip to the next, engaging the viewer and keeping them interested. With a template, you can arrange your footage in a logical sequence, add transitions and effects, and create a narrative that highlights your skills and experience. By using a template, you can focus on crafting a compelling storyline rather than worrying about the technical aspects of editing.

Another benefit of reel templates is their versatility. Whether you specialize in commercial work, documentaries, music videos, or any other type of video production, there are templates available to suit your needs. From sleek and modern designs to more traditional layouts, you can find a template that complements your style and helps you showcase your work in the best possible light. Additionally, many templates are customizable, allowing you to add your own branding, colors, and graphics to make your reel truly unique.

In addition to their aesthetic appeal, reel templates also offer practical benefits. Many templates are designed with specific platforms in mind, such as YouTube, Vimeo, or social media. This means that your reel will be optimized for viewing on these platforms, ensuring that your work looks its best no matter where it is shared. Furthermore, templates often come with built-in features such as pre-made animations, text placeholders, and music tracks, making it easy to create a professional-looking reel without the need for extensive editing skills.
